A Chinese man who committed fraud worth more than KRW 6.2 billion for presenting an expensive house and sports car to his girlfriend was arrested.

According to Hong Kong media South China Morning Post, a man named Liu from Chengdu, Sichuan Province, China, was accused of committing 32.7 million yuan (about 6.22 billion won) of fraud to give his girlfriend a luxurious gift.

He was found to have deceived the victims by falsifying contracts, business licenses, and company seals.




According to police investigations, he signed leases without gas station goodwill and took deposits, and deceived local energy companies and their stocks to receive rent.

It is also accused of defrauding investment funds from oil companies using fake equity transfer agreements.

Police found that a total of 32.7 million yuan was defrauded from more than 70 people from September 2019 until recently.




Investigators have identified more than 80 bank accounts and more than 300,000 financial transactions in his name, and authorities have frozen or confiscated the remaining 25 million yuan (about 4.762 billion won) of his assets. The current case has been handed over to the prosecution.

He claimed that he did not use the money he received from fraud for himself.

According to the police, most of the money was spent on her girlfriend. Despite being unemployed, the girlfriend maintained a luxurious life by purchasing Porsche sports cars and several villas, according to the survey.




Rio, on the other hand, had no home and car, and lived with his parents, rarely buying clothes or delivering food on his own, police said.

Under Chinese law, large fraud cases can lead to more than a decade in prison, life in prison, heavy fines or confiscation of assets.
